Prioritize Robust Construction and Durability

When it comes to automotive tools, especially those that exert significant force, construction quality is non-negotiable. A reliable ball joint press kit must be built to withstand immense pressure without compromising its structural integrity. Look for a kit centered around a heavy-duty C-frame press, which is the heart of the tool. Ideally, this frame should be constructed from forged steel or thick-gauge, heat-treated alloy steel. These materials offer superior strength and rigidity, preventing bending, cracking, or deformation under the high loads required to remove stubborn ball joints.
Beyond the C-frame, examine the forcing screw. It should be made from hardened steel with fine, precision-cut threads to ensure smooth operation and maximum force transfer. A longer forcing screw handle significantly increases leverage, reducing the physical effort required and making the job easier on your arms and shoulders. Furthermore, a comprehensive kit should include a diverse selection of adapters, installation cups, and receiving tubes. This variety ensures you have the correct components to safely press out and install ball joints of various sizes and designs, minimizing the risk of damaging the new ball joint or surrounding suspension parts. Investing in a robustly constructed kit translates directly into longevity, reliability, and safety for years of demanding use.
Focus on Premium Material Quality
Automotive tools operate in harsh environments, often exposed to grime, chemicals, and significant stress. Therefore, the material quality of your ball joint press kit is paramount for long-term performance and durability. Forged steel is widely regarded as the gold standard, offering exceptional strength and resistance to wear and fatigue. This material undergoes a process that improves its grain structure, making it incredibly resilient against the repetitive impacts and pressures inherent in ball joint service.
Beyond the core material, consider the finishes and coatings applied to the components. Tools stored in damp garages or used in corrosive environments are prone to rust and corrosion, which can seize threads, weaken parts, and compromise functionality. Features like black oxide finishes, chrome plating, or electrocoating provide a crucial protective barrier. These coatings not only enhance the tool’s appearance but, more importantly, extend its operational life by guarding against moisture, road salt, and automotive fluids. A kit that boasts high-quality materials and protective coatings will remain in optimal working condition for significantly longer, reducing the need for premature replacements and ensuring your investment pays off over time.

Assess Kit Versatility and Multi-Purpose Functionality
While a ball joint press kit is specifically designed for ball joint replacement, some kits offer expanded versatility, making them a more valuable investment for a busy garage or a dedicated DIY mechanic. Specialized kits might only handle ball joints, but many comprehensive sets are engineered for multi-purpose use. These versatile kits can often be adapted to service other suspension and steering components, such as U-joints, tie rods, universal joints, and even some wheel bearings or bushings.
If your automotive repair needs extend beyond just ball joints, opting for a multi-use kit can save you significant money and storage space in the long run. Instead of purchasing separate tools for each specific task, a single, versatile kit provides the necessary adapters and components for a broader range of jobs. This enhanced functionality makes your investment more cost-effective and helps streamline your workflow. Before buying, consider your future repair needs and determine if a specialized or multi-functional kit better aligns with your workshop requirements.
Consider Storage and Portability

Ball joint press kits, especially those with numerous adapters and components, can be quite bulky. The size and storage solution of the kit are important considerations, particularly for mobile mechanics or those with limited workshop space. If you operate out of a compact home garage or frequently work on vehicles at different locations, a more compact and portable kit will be easier to transport and store. These kits often feature a thoughtful design that maximizes component density without sacrificing functionality.
Conversely, for a full-scale professional automotive shop with ample storage, a larger, more comprehensive kit with a wider range of specialized adapters might be more beneficial. Regardless of size, a high-quality storage case is essential. A blow-molded plastic case with custom-fit compartments for each tool component is ideal. This type of case keeps everything neatly organized, protected from damage, and readily accessible when you need it. It prevents lost parts, simplifies inventory, and ensures your tools are always ready for the next job, saving valuable time during set-up and clean-up.
